How Our Under Sink Water Extraction Process Works
When you call us for under sink water extraction, our team springs into action to mitigate the damage and prevent further problems. We understand that every minute counts, and our rapid response times are designed to reduce the impact on your daily life.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to get your property back to normal.
Step 1: Initial Assessment and Containment
Our team will arrive at your property and assess the extent of the damage, containing the affected area to prevent further water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to prevent secondary damage and ensure the area is safe for our technicians to work in.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al
Using our truck-mounted extractors, we’ll remove the standing water from your property, including under the sink and surrounding areas. Our technicians will carefully extract the water to prevent damage to your floors, walls, and other surfaces.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to dry out your property, including the air and any affected materials.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Finally, our team will work with you to repair or replace any damaged materials and fixtures, restoring your property to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Under Sink Water Extraction
Ignoring the signs of under sink water damage can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Here are some warning signs to watch out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ell under your sink, it may be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us today.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s a clear indication that water is seeping into your property. Act fast to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ring

Under Sink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ak under the sink | Yes | No | You can likely fix the issue yourself with a wrench and some basic plumbing knowledge. |
| Standing water under the sink, affecting multiple rooms | No | Yes | A professional will need to extract the water and dry out the affected area to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age under the sink, causing structural issues | No | Yes | A professional will need to assess and repair any structural damage to ensure your property is safe. |

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Pilot Point, TX
The cost of under sink water extraction in Pilot Point, TX, var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the job. Keep in mind that every situation is unique, and our team will provide a customized estimate after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Containment | $200-$500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500-$1,500 | Amount of water, type of flooring and surfaces |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$300-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
